AI 编程教程中文版
官方教程中文版团队与集成

了解开源入口

OpenAI 会以 open 的方式开发 Codex 的关键部分。

📖 本篇术语速查表
英文 / 缩写中文一句话解释
开源组件OSS componentsCodex 生态里开源的那部分组件。
组件边界component scope分清哪个问题该去哪个组件反馈。
高质量 issuequality issue含复现、环境、预期的有效问题报告。

不想读完?把下面这段提示词丢给 AI 帮你跑完——帮你分清开源组件边界、写出高质量 issue 或贡献。

你是 Codex 开源参与顾问,帮我分清该去哪个开源组件反馈、写出能被接受的高质量 issue 或贡献。

【角色】
你了解 Codex 的开源组件、在哪里报告问题和提需求、贡献前怎么分清组件边界、高质量 issue 应包含什么。

【输入】
- 我遇到的问题或想提的需求:___
- 涉及的功能 / 组件:___
- 我能提供的复现信息:___
- 我想贡献的方式(报 bug / 提 PR / 提需求):___

【工作流程】
1. 判断这个问题属于哪个开源组件
2. 确认该去哪里报告 / 贡献
3. 帮我把信息整理成高质量 issue(复现 / 环境 / 预期)
4. 给贡献前的注意事项

【输出规范】
▌一、问题归属的组件
▌二、报告 / 贡献的正确入口
▌三、高质量 issue 草稿(复现 / 环境 / 预期 / 实际)
▌四、贡献注意事项

【硬约束】
- 先分清组件边界,别报错地方
- issue 必须含可复现信息,不只说"不工作"
- 尊重各组件的贡献规范
- 敏感信息不放进公开 issue
- 不确定的归属标注需查官方仓库

OpenAI 会以 open 的方式开发 Codex 的关键部分。

这些工作位于 GitHub,方便你跟踪进展、报告 issues,并贡献 improvements。

如果你维护 widely used open-source project,或想 nominate 那些 stewarding important projects 的 maintainers,也可以申请 Codex for OSS program,获得 API credits、ChatGPT Pro with Codex,以及 Codex Security 的 selective access。

Open-Source Components

ComponentWhere to findNotes
Codex CLIopenai/codexCodex open-source development 的主要位置。
Codex SDKopenai/codex/sdkSDK sources 位于 Codex repo 中。
Codex App Serveropenai/codex/codex-rs/app-serverApp-server sources 位于 Codex repo 中。
Skillsopenai/skills扩展 Codex 的 reusable skills。
IDE extension-Not open source。
Codex web-Not open source。
Universal cloud environmentopenai/codex-universalCodex cloud 使用的 base environment。

Where to Report Issues and Request Features

Codex components 的 bug reports 和 feature requests 都使用 Codex GitHub repository:

提交 issue 时,请尽量包含你使用的 component,例如 CLI、SDK、IDE extension 或 Codex web,以及对应 version。

贡献前先分清组件边界

Codex 不是所有部分都开源。开 issue 或提交 PR 前,先判断你遇到的问题属于哪个层:

现象优先入口
CLI 命令、TUI、配置、sandbox、rules、MCP 行为异常openai/codex issue。
SDK 类型、thread 控制、server-side integration 问题openai/codex repo 的 SDK 区域。
Cloud environment 基础镜像缺包或版本问题openai/codex-universal
Skill 结构、示例、可复用 workflowopenai/skills
IDE extension 或 Codex web 产品体验官方 docs、support 或对应反馈入口;不要假设源码可改。

这一步能减少无效 issue。比如“VS Code extension 的 UI 按钮不显示”不能直接当成 openai/codex CLI bug;“universal image 缺系统包”也不应发到 skills repo。

高质量 issue 应包含什么

提交前准备:

  • Codex version。
  • OS 和 shell。
  • 入口:CLI、SDK、app server、Cloud、IDE、Web。
  • 最小复现命令或步骤。
  • 期望行为和实际行为。
  • 相关 config 片段,删掉 token、key、cookie 和私有路径。
  • 如果是 Cloud 或 remote,说明 environment、repo、branch、setup script 是否相关。

如果问题涉及安全、凭据或 private repo,不要把敏感材料直接贴到 public issue。先走官方安全或支持渠道。

官方资料

本页目录